存clob字段过长

232 2024-02-27 15:50

在数据库设计和管理中,存储大段文本数据时可能会遇到存clob字段过长的问题。在这种情况下,需要仔细考虑如何有效地处理和存储这些长文本字段。

存储CLOB字段过长的挑战

存储CLOB字段过长可能会导致数据库性能下降,影响数据的读写速度以及查询效率。此外,过长的CLOB字段还可能导致数据不规范、冗余或难以维护。

为了解决存储CLOB字段过长的挑战,需要考虑以下几个方面:

  • 数据模型设计:确保数据库表的设计符合规范,包括合适的字段长度限制和数据类型选择。
  • 数据存储策略:根据实际需求,选择合适的存储方式,如将大文本数据存储在文件系统而不是数据库中。
  • 数据清洗和规范化:定期清理和规范化数据,避免存储过长、冗余或无效的文本字段。

优化CLOB字段存储

为了优化CLOB字段的存储,可以考虑以下几种方法:

  • 分段存储:将长文本数据分段存储,可以提高数据库读写效率并减少存储空间的占用。
  • 索引优化:使用合适的索引策略来加速对CLOB字段的查询操作,提高数据库性能。
  • 压缩技术:使用数据压缩技术来减少CLOB字段存储空间,提高数据库性能和效率。

通过以上优化方法,可以有效解决存储CLOB字段过长带来的问题,提升数据库性能和数据管理效率。

存储CLOB字段过长的最佳实践

在存储CLOB字段过长时,建议遵循以下最佳实践:

  • 合理设计数据模型:在数据库设计阶段就考虑到长文本数据的存储需求,避免后续出现存储过长字段的问题。
  • 定期优化数据库:定期清理和优化数据库表结构、索引以及数据,确保数据库运行稳定高效。
  • 监控数据库性能:定期监控数据库性能指标,及时发现存储CLOB字段过长导致的性能问题并进行调整。

综上所述,存储CLOB字段过长是数据库设计和管理中常见的挑战,但通过合理的设计和优化方法,可以有效解决这一问题,提高数据库性能和数据管理效率。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片